
CAS 156212-81-6
:1H-Benzimidazole-2-carboxaldehyde,6-chloro-1-methyl-(9CI)
Description:
1H-Benzimidazole-2-carboxaldehyde, 6-chloro-1-methyl- (CAS 156212-81-6) is a chemical compound characterized by its benzimidazole core, which is a bicyclic structure containing both benzene and imidazole rings. This compound features a carboxaldehyde functional group at the 2-position and a chlorine atom at the 6-position, along with a methyl group at the 1-position of the benzimidazole ring. The presence of these functional groups contributes to its reactivity and potential applications in various fields, including pharmaceuticals and agrochemicals. The compound is typically a solid at room temperature and may exhibit moderate solubility in organic solvents. Its structure suggests potential biological activity, making it of interest for research in medicinal chemistry. Additionally, the chlorine substituent may influence its electronic properties and interactions with biological targets. As with many chemical substances, safety precautions should be observed when handling this compound, as it may pose health risks or environmental hazards.
Formula:C9H7ClN2O
